Delhi DoE Class 9, 11 Result 2026 Date and Time: Check when and how to download scorecards from edudel.nic

Delhi Directorate of Education (DoE) is expected to declare the Class 9 and Class 11 annual examination results today, i.e. on March 30, 2026. Students taking the exams will be able to check and download their score cards online after the results are announced.

Delhi DoE Class 9, 11 Result 2026 Date and Time

Delhi DoE Class 9, 11 results may be declared today. However, the timings are yet to be confirmed. Once the results are declared, students can check and download the results from the official website edudel.nic.in. This marks the end of the 2025-26 academic session for secondary and high school students under the Delhi government school system.

Delhi DoE Class 9, 11 results 2026: Download steps

Students can check this year’s Delhi DoE Class 9, 11 results by following this step-by-step guide:

Go to the official website at edudel.nic.in.

Go to the “What’s New” section on the home page
For Class 9 and Class 11, click on the “Results 2025–26” link.

Enter the required details including your class, student ID, department and date of birth.

After your application, your result will be displayed on the screen.

Download the scorecard and keep a copy for future reference.

It is pertinent to note that students who pass the Grade 9 or 11 exams will be promoted to the next grade (Grade 10 and Grade 12 respectively). Those who are not successful in the exams can take make-up or development exams.

Parents and students are advised to carefully verify all details mentioned in the scorecard and immediately report any discrepancies to school authorities. Original report cards and detailed evaluations will also be distributed by the respective schools.

Delhi School Class 9, 11 results 2026: Details in mark sheet

After downloading the result students must carefully verify the following details in the scorecard:

Personal Identification: Full name, father’s name, mother’s name, date of birth and photo.

Academic Details: School name, class, department, session and registration number/ID.

Performance by Subject: Marks achieved in theory, practice and internal assessments for each subject.

Performance Measures: Subject-wise marks, Cumulative Grade Point Average (CGPA), total marks obtained and overall percentage.

Result Status: Clearly stated as “Pass”, “Fail” or “Promoted to the next grade”.

What to do in case of differences

The Directorate of Education (DoE) has advised students and parents to carefully verify all the details mentioned in the online marking sheet. In case of any discrepancies (such as incorrect signs, spelling errors in names or incorrect personal information) students must immediately report this to the relevant school authorities for correction.

Physical copies of the report cards along with detailed evaluations will be distributed to schools within the next 7-10 business days.

Students are also advised to be aware of announcements regarding additional exams and distribution of grades. If they encounter any technical issues while checking their results online, they should contact their school’s IT support or administrative office.
